Technical Context
The M10082040054X0PWAY implements a 40nm pMTJ STT-MRAM array with Quad SPI (QPI) interface supporting 1-4-4 command-address-data nomenclature. It operates in Double Data Rate mode at 54MHz using both clock edges for address/data transfer, enabling sub-100ns random read access while maintaining full non-volatility.
It integrates hardware-based write protection via dedicated WP# pin and software-controlled block protection through configurable Status and Configuration Registers. The device supports eXecute-In-Place (XIP), Deep Power Down (≤3µs entry), and Hibernate modes - all preserving data and register state without external backup power.

Pinout & Package
8-pad DFN (WSON) package, 5.0mm × 6.0mm body, wettable flank leads, RoHS-compliant matte tin finish.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| CS# | Chip Select Input | Active-low enable signal; falling edge initiates instruction sequence; high state places device in standby (ISB current). |
| WP# / IO[2] | Bidirectional Write Protect / Data Line 2 | Hardware write lock for Status Register when low (with WP#EN=1); also serves as QPI data lane IO[2] in quad mode. |
| SI / IO[0] | Input / Bidirectional Data Line 0 | Serial input in single-SPI; primary command/address/data lane in QPI (IO[0]); must be driven, no internal pull-up. |
| CLK | Clock Input | Synchronous timing reference; DDR mode uses both rising and falling edges for address/data latching. |
| IO[3] | Bidirectional Data Line 3 | QPI data lane; tri-stated when unused; may be tied to VCC if single/dual SPI only. |
| SO / IO[1] | Output / Bidirectional Data Line 1 | Serial output in single-SPI; QPI data lane IO[1]; data always outputs on falling clock edge (SDR & DDR). |
| VCC | Power Supply | Single supply for core and I/O; supports 1.8V or 3.3V operation; requires local 100nF decoupling. |
| VSS | Ground | Common return path for core and I/O; must be low-impedance connection to minimize noise coupling. |

FAQ
What is the exact memory density and organization of the M10082040054X0PWAY?
The M10082040054X0PWAY is an 8 Megabit (8,388,608-bit) serial MRAM organized as 1,048,576 words × 8 bits. Its address space spans 000000h–0FFFFFh (20-bit addressing), with the upper 4 address bits fixed to '0'. This matches the documented 8Mb density in the Valid Combinations table and Memory Map section of the datasheet.
Does the M10082040054X0PWAY support both Single Data Rate (SDR) and Double Data Rate (DDR) SPI modes?
No - the M10082040054X0PWAY is specifically rated for 54MHz Double Data Rate (DDR) operation, as indicated by "0054" in its part number suffix. It does not support SDR mode at 108MHz; that variant is designated by "0108" (e.g., M10082040108X0PWAY). The datasheet confirms DDR timing parameters only for 0054-part numbers.
What package type and dimensions does the M10082040054X0PWAY use?
The M10082040054X0PWAY uses the 8-pad DFN (WSON) package, 5.0mm × 6.0mm body size, with wettable flank leads. This is confirmed by the "WA" in the part number and explicitly shown in Figure 3 (Page 9) and Package Drawing 5.1 (Page 10) of the datasheet.
How does hardware write protection work on the M10082040054X0PWAY?
Hardware write protection on the M10082040054X0PWAY is implemented via the WP# pin (Pin 2), which controls Status Register write access when WP#EN bit (SR[7]) is set to '1'. When WP# is driven low, the Status Register becomes read-only - preventing modification of block protection bits, serial number lock, and top/bottom selection. The pin has no internal pull-up and must be actively driven.
Is the M10082040054X0PWAY compatible with standard SPI controllers?
Yes - the M10082040054X0PWAY supports standard SPI protocols including SPI Mode 0 (CPOL=0, CPHA=0) and SPI Mode 3 (CPOL=1, CPHA=1) in Single SPI mode. In Quad SPI (QPI) mode, it uses the JEDEC-standard 4-4-4 command-address-data format, ensuring interoperability with common MCU SPI peripherals configured for quad I/O.
